A floating garden island filled with fragrance

MadeiraThe island of Madeira is thirteen miles (21km) wide and thirty-five miles (56km) long and has no beaches - but it does have lush botanical landscapes and rich volcanic earth, and its colourful masses of orchids, bougainvillea, frangipani, wisteria and geraniums fill the air with fragrance. Fruit and herbs grow in profusion on the hillsides and in ravines, and the mountain slopes are terraced with orchards and vineyards.

The Portuguese island of Madeira is situated more than 600 miles (966km) south west of Lisbon, a mere speck in the vast Atlantic Ocean. Madeira, along with its sister island of Porto Santo, is the summit of an undersea mountain, rearing up with craggy cliffs from the warm blue Gulf Stream waters in one of the deepest parts of the Atlantic. It features one of the world's highest ocean cliffs, which soars 1,933 feet (589m) above the sea and presented a forbidding sight to the ancient Portuguese mariners who first discovered the island archipelago in the 15th century.
